P0226 is a Generic OBD-II Powertrain code indicating a range or performance problem with the Throttle/Pedal Position Sensor/Switch C circuit. The PCM/ECM has detected that the C position signal is not behaving within the expected operating range or does not correlate correctly with the expected throttle or pedal position.
The exact sensor and circuit configuration varies between manufacturers. On some vehicles, the C signal is part of the electronic throttle body, while on others it can be associated with the accelerator pedal position system.
What Does P0226 Mean?
P0226 means the PCM/ECM has detected a range/performance problem in the Throttle/Pedal Position Sensor/Switch C circuit.
The signal may be present, but its value can be implausible, outside the expected range, inconsistent with another position signal, or not responding correctly to throttle or accelerator-pedal movement.
Is P0226 Generic or Manufacturer Specific?
P0226 is a Generic OBD-II Powertrain code. However, the exact component, pinout, signal voltage, operating range, and diagnostic procedure are manufacturer-specific.
What Is Sensor C?
Sensor C is a designated throttle or pedal position signal used by the engine-control system. Modern electronic throttle systems commonly use multiple position signals for redundancy and safety monitoring.
Depending on the vehicle, sensor C may be integrated into:
- Electronic throttle body.
- Accelerator pedal assembly.
- Another manufacturer-specific throttle/pedal position circuit.
Where Is the P0226 Sensor Located?
If the C signal belongs to the electronic throttle body, the sensor is normally integrated into the throttle body located in the engine intake system.
If the C signal belongs to the accelerator-pedal system, the relevant sensor may be integrated into the accelerator pedal assembly inside the passenger compartment.

Driver Side or Passenger Side?
P0226 does not identify the left or right side of the vehicle. The “C” designation refers to the manufacturer's assigned sensor/signal circuit.
Common Symptoms of P0226
- Check Engine Light.
- Reduced engine power.
- Limp-home mode.
- Hesitation during acceleration.
- Poor throttle response.
- Delayed accelerator response.
- Engine surging.
- Unstable acceleration.
- Possible stalling in severe cases.
Common Causes of P0226
- Throttle/pedal position sensor C fault.
- Throttle body internal sensor problem.
- Accelerator-pedal position sensor fault.
- Damaged wiring.
- Open signal circuit.
- Shorted signal circuit.
- Loose connector.
- Corroded terminals.
- Damaged connector pins.
- Incorrect reference voltage.
- Poor sensor ground.
- Signal interference or instability.
- Mechanical throttle problem.
- Water or contamination in a connector.
- PCM/ECM fault, although this is less common.
Why Does P0226 Occur?
The PCM continuously evaluates throttle and pedal position information. If the C signal does not correspond to the expected operating range or does not agree with other available position information, the PCM can set P0226.
Unlike a simple low-input or high-input code, P0226 focuses on range or performance. The signal may exist electrically but still be considered implausible by the control module.
Typical Sensor C Signal
A properly functioning position sensor should produce a smooth and predictable change as throttle or accelerator-pedal position changes.
The PCM may also compare the C signal against another redundant position signal.
There is no single universal voltage specification for P0226. Use the exact manufacturer's specifications for the vehicle being diagnosed.
How to Diagnose P0226
1. Scan the PCM
Use a professional scan tool to retrieve P0226 and all related stored and pending codes.
2. Check Freeze Frame Data
Record engine RPM, vehicle speed, throttle position, accelerator position, engine load, and other available parameters at the time the fault occurred.
3. Monitor Live Data
Observe the available throttle and accelerator-pedal position parameters while slowly operating the accelerator.
Look for:
- Unexpected jumps.
- Dead spots.
- Incorrect correlation.
- Values that remain fixed.
- Signals that do not follow pedal movement.
4. Compare Redundant Sensors
Where multiple position signals are available, compare their relationship while moving the accelerator pedal.
An incorrect correlation can indicate a sensor, wiring, connector, or mechanical problem.
5. Inspect the Connector
Inspect the relevant connector for loose terminals, corrosion, water intrusion, damaged pins, broken locks, or poor engagement.
6. Inspect the Wiring
Check the harness for chafing, damaged insulation, stretched wires, crushed sections, heat damage, and previous repairs.
7. Check Reference and Ground
Following the manufacturer's diagnostic procedure, verify the sensor reference and ground circuits with the appropriate test equipment.
8. Test the Signal Circuit
Use the vehicle-specific wiring diagram to identify the C signal circuit and verify continuity and circuit integrity according to the manufacturer's procedure.
Never assume wire colors or connector pin numbers are identical between manufacturers.
9. Inspect the Throttle Mechanism
If applicable, check for mechanical binding, abnormal throttle movement, or other problems that could cause the position signal to disagree with the expected throttle position.
10. Clear and Retest
After repairing the confirmed fault, clear P0226 and perform a complete functional and road-test verification.

P0226 vs P0225, P0227 and P0228
- P0225: Throttle/Pedal Position Sensor/Switch C Circuit.
- P0226: Sensor/Switch C Circuit Range/Performance.
- P0227: Sensor/Switch C Circuit Low Input.
- P0228: Sensor/Switch C Circuit High Input.
P0226 is particularly associated with an implausible range or performance condition rather than simply a permanently low or high electrical input.
Can the Throttle Body Cause P0226?
Yes. If the C position sensor is integrated into the electronic throttle body, an internal sensor fault or throttle-position problem can cause P0226.
Can the Accelerator Pedal Cause P0226?
Yes, depending on the vehicle. Some vehicles use multiple accelerator-pedal position signals that are monitored for range and correlation.
Can Wiring Cause P0226?
Yes. Damaged wiring, poor terminals, intermittent connections, or incorrect reference/ground circuits can make the C signal appear implausible.
Can a Dirty Throttle Body Cause P0226?
A dirty throttle body can contribute to throttle-control problems, but contamination should not automatically be identified as the cause. The sensor signals and electrical circuits should be tested first.
Can a Weak Battery Cause P0226?
Low system voltage can sometimes contribute to electronic throttle faults. However, a persistent P0226 requires proper circuit and sensor diagnosis.
Is P0226 Serious?
P0226 can be serious. Throttle and accelerator-position information is important to engine torque control. The vehicle may enter reduced-power or fail-safe operation.
Can You Drive With P0226?
The vehicle may continue to run, but throttle response can become limited or unpredictable. If reduced power, severe hesitation, or loss of throttle response occurs, the vehicle should be diagnosed before continued operation.

Common Repair Mistakes
- Replacing the throttle body without testing the circuit.
- Replacing the accelerator pedal without checking wiring.
- Assuming “C” always refers to the same physical sensor.
- Using generic voltage values instead of OEM specifications.
- Ignoring sensor correlation data.
- Ignoring connector terminal problems.
- Replacing the PCM too early.
- Clearing the code without verifying the repair.
